" The Ninevites believed God. They declared a fast, and all of them, from the greatest to the least, put on sackcloth. " - Jonah 3:5

believe God.
we all do. or are supposed to.
but do we, really, really really BELIEVE God?

HOW does one measure belief?
simple: by action.
"They declared a fast, and all of them, from the greatest to the least, put on sackcloth."

if i told u that the sky was going to rain BEN&JERRY'S ice cream tomorrow, and u really really truly believed me, what would u do?
i think u would gather as many pails and buckets as u can find and lay them out in the open to collect as much ice cream goodness as possible.
if u hadn't done that, then chances are u doubted what i said. "where got.. as if.. siao ah.."
our actions belie our belief.

Scripture tells us that ALL of them put on sackcloth.
it teaches us something about CORPORATE BELIEF.

Scripture specified that all included both the GREATEST and the LEAST.
it teaches us something about HUMILITY.
